The real reason I'm leaving a review is to talk about the minor perks. At base, its 36 stability and 73 Recoil makes the sight kick too much for my liking. After some experimenting, Chambered Compensator + Flared Magwell/Tactical Mag + Counterbalance Stock + Stability masterwork will leave you at 61 Stability at 98 Recoil. This leaves it with an extremely manageable kick while maintaining the vertical recoil that you'd get from using just Arrowhead Brake. Makes it very comfortable to use when going between/maintaining targets at the mid to longer ranges of a pulse. Extra bonus on the reload speed from Flared or Tactical mags.

PVE: Great, absolutely fantastic. It's a little weird feeling like you get fewer shots, since the bursts are two instead of three, and the mag size is so much lower as a result. However, the damage it outputs is quite competitive, letting you shred through enemies about as quickly (maybe a touch faster?) than a Rapid Fire frame (which is one of the better PVE options for a pulse). Things died way more quickly than what I was expecting. It's a little jarring to adjust to having to lay into the trigger quite so frequently, but if you're a Graviton Lance oldhead, it's like slipping into a different color of your favorite pair of shoes. It kicks FAR less than the Lance, and has a really nice, manageable recoil that I barely noticed on my most used roll (though that did have Extended Barrel to bring it to 83). Firefly was really nice, giving it some AOE and the quicker reload, BUT I was mostly using this in the raid during contest mode, and I swear to god those little flying guys are the MOST annoying things I've ever seen when it comes to trying to hit a moving target. I didn't like Adrenaline Junkie here that much, but I could see it being very effective with Demolitionist. Fourth Times was pretty bad, as expected, so once I lucked into Heal Clip/Incandescent, I never looked back. This is a great roll, and I've been using it in everything to replace my Luna's Howl if I need either anti-barrier or a longer range weapon. Really, really nice. I have not played around with the new raid perk, Chaos Reshaped, very much, though my understanding is that it's similar to Frenzy, but with two stacks that max out at ~24 seconds or so. This is a long period of time to be in combat for a damage boost alone, but it also gives a small heal. The 35% damage increase at 2 stacks is really, really nice, but I'd honestly prefer the extra reload speed from Frenzy, not gonna lie. This might be the pairing perk if you want to use Firefly. Otherwise, you're probably looking at Demo/Junkie or Heal Clip/Incand.
PVP: This was really, really unfun to use. Had to catch everyone by surprise in order to win my ones, because it's so easy for hand cannons, autos, other pulses, even some scouts, to eat you alive before you can get that third burst off.
tldr this gun feels like it was made for PVE, where it really thrives, especially when combined and playing into the solar kit
EDIT: I burned two harmonizers on this, and have been messing around with perks. Chaos Reshaped takes forever to kick in, which I don't mind so much on Frenzy. However, it seems like (and please, correct me if I'm wrong) it doesn't proc while the weapon is stowed, and appears to wear off more quickly than Frenzy (I didn't stare at it to time out the buff, but I noticed it dropping off while I was still in combat during a level 4 Overthrow against a tormentor). If this isn't the case, Chaos Reshaped could be an interesting GM pick, paired with Rapid Hit. Right now, I'm enjoying Firefly/Incandescent, though it's highly likely I'll swap to Heal Clip due to extra survivability + Benevolence.
Heal Clip + Chaos Reshaped/Incandescent is also another roll worthy of being crafted.
